The Minister of Defence of Estonia announced the anticipation of cooperation with Ukraine regarding the acquisition of weapons in its industry. Today, however, Kiev cannot export it due to the fact that it is legally prohibited due to the declared martial law. In the opinion of the head of the Estonian MON, it is possible to scope an agreement in which it would be possible for Tallinn to acquisition arms in the Ukrainian industry, which would let for a crucial improvement in its performance and greater profit. Among the military equipment under consideration are drones, which, however, may become problematic due to the usage of Chinese components for their manufacture.
